Job Title: Professional 1, Engineering Intern
Location: Columbus, NE
What's the Job?
- Support in a fast-paced, high-volume manufacturing environment to ensure smooth operations.
- Assist with troubleshooting and root cause analysis to resolve technical issues.
- Collaborate with a mentor on project assignments aligned with your academic background.
- Apply classroom knowledge to real-world applications, gaining valuable hands-on experience.
- Contribute to process improvements and operational efficiency initiatives.
- Currently pursuing a degree in Engineering or related field, with at least completed sophomore year.
- Legally authorized to work in the United States.
- Available to work a minimum of eight continuous weeks on 1st shift (flexible start time between 7AM and 8AM).
- Ability to read, write, and communicate effectively in English.
- Familiarity with SolidWorks or AutoCAD (preferred), along with an interest in fabrication, automation, or industrial processes (preferred).
